Geisler Electric
Manhattan electrical contractor offering general wiring and occasional standby generator service
While Manhattan-based Geisler Electric primarily focuses on general electrical services, automation, and security work, their site includes a reference to generator installations. Feedback from local clients confirms they handle whole-house generator troubleshooting and servicing when needed. Homeowners considering a new standby installation should contact them directly to clarify their current generator project scope and brand options.
A single generator-specific review highlights prompt and clear service when troubleshooting a whole-house system before severe weather.
